Morrow Turf Conditions

Morrow sits on some seriously dense Clayton County clay, which presents a unique challenge for any yard project. Natural grass struggles here because water doesn't drain the way it should, creating puddles that stick around for days after a rain. Dogs love these puddles, naturally, which means your lawn becomes a mud delivery system. Our artificial turf installation starts with proper base preparation to manage that clay—we're not just rolling sod over compacted soil and hoping for the best. We assess your yard's slope, check for drainage issues, and build a sub-base that keeps water moving instead of pooling. The Southlake Mall area and neighborhoods closer to Clayton State tend to have mixed sun exposure, so we'll help you choose between our premium drainage turf and our pet-specific blends based on whether your yard gets afternoon heat. Most residential yards in Morrow range from quarter-acre to half-acre, which is ideal for synthetic green installation. We've also worked with several properties that have HOA guidelines—Clayton County communities sometimes have specific rules about turf color and pile height, so we always verify those details upfront before we start digging.

Frequently Asked Questions

Will artificial turf drain properly with Morrow's clay soil?

Absolutely. Clayton County clay is why proper drainage base matters so much. We install a compacted stone and gravel foundation that channels water through and away from the turf, rather than letting it sit on top of the clay like it would with natural grass. Your yard stays dry, your dog stays clean, and you're not staring at swampy patches in summer.

How long does installation take for a typical Morrow backyard?

Most residential installations take 2–3 days, depending on yard size and base work. If your property needs significant grading or drainage corrections—common in the Southlake Mall and Clayton State neighborhoods—it might run to 4 days. We'll give you an exact timeline during the site visit.

Is artificial turf safe for dogs?

Yes, with the right product. We install pet-grade artificial turf designed to handle claws, heavy traffic, and waste without breaking down. The blades are durable, and the drainage system means urine doesn't pool. It's far cleaner than natural grass for dogs.

What about heat in Georgia summers? Won't it be too hot for my dog?

Our premium turf stays cooler than basic synthetic options, and Morrow's mix of shade and sun means most yards have spots your dog can retreat to. We can also advise on heat-resistant varieties and discuss shade structures if you're concerned about direct afternoon sun.
